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Modern Facilities and Amenities

At North Dulwich Station, purchasing and collecting your tickets is a breeze. The ticket office is open from as early as 06:00 AM and closes at 21:15 PM on weekdays, with slightly reduced hours on weekends. If you're someone who prefers to plan ahead, ticket machines are available for quick purchases, including options for collecting tickets bought online. These machines are accessible to all, providing disc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ders.

Despite the absence of step-free access, the station is committed to assisting all travelers. Help points, equipped with emergency and travel assistance buttons, are strategically placed on platforms for immediate support. Staff are typically available during opening hours to lend a helping hand with ramps and other accessibility needs.

Onward Journeys Made Easy

North Dulwich Station is well-connected by various transport links, making onward journeys hassle-free. Although there isn’t a dedicated parking lot or cycle hire facilities, you will find bicycle stands at the station's entrance. For those relying on bus services, the 'Onward Travel Information Map' provides comprehensive details to facilitate your journey. Additionally, in instances of train service interruptions, rail replacement services are efficiently organized.

Station Facilities

For anyone planning a journey from Chilworth Station, it is essential to note that the station does not have a ticket office or ticket machines. Travelers must secure their tickets online before arrival. Helpful amenities are limited, but a sense of old-world charm pervades. There is an induction loop for those who require it, along with some seating available. While waiting rooms and first-class lounges are absent, outdoor seating areas provide a space for passengers to rest before embarking on their train journey.

Passenger assistance is on offer if arranged in advance through the Passenger Assist service. This is a station that works to ensure accessibility needs are met as best as possible, with step-free access provided via ramps to both platforms. However, remember to cross the level crossing if you're switching platforms.

Onward Travel Options

While Chilworth is charming, the station's conveniences are modest, and onward travel options reflect that simplicity. Bus shelters in both directions serve waiting passengers, aiding transitions during rail replacement services. However, there's a notable absence of taxis directly available at the station. For those on two wheels, bicycle hire is not offered, though sheltered bicycle storage at Platform 2 accommodates those riding their own bikes.
